Understanding Water Quality Challenges in Evergreen, CO

Homeowners in Evergreen, CO 80437 often face several common water issues due to the local geology and water sources. These problems include high levels of iron, sulfur odors, hard water deposits, staining on fixtures, and scale buildup in appliances. These water quality problems can affect daily life by causing unpleasant tastes and smells, damaging plumbing, and reducing the lifespan of household appliances.

Common Water Problems and Their Impact

  • Iron: Causes reddish or brown stains on sinks and laundry, and can give water a metallic taste.
  • Sulfur: Produces a rotten egg odor that can be unpleasant and difficult to remove.
  • Hardness: Leads to mineral scale buildup that reduces water heater efficiency and clogs pipes.
  • Stains and Odors: Affect the appearance of clothing and fixtures and reduce overall water enjoyment.
  • Scale: Causes damage to appliances like dishwashers, washing machines, and coffee makers.

The Role of the Equipo Viqua 3 GPM UV System

The Equipo Viqua 3 GPM ultraviolet (UV) water treatment system is designed specifically to address microbial contamination, which is an important consideration in many local water sources. UV systems use ultraviolet light to neutralize bacteria, viruses, and other microorganisms without adding chemicals to your water.

While UV treatment does not remove minerals like iron or hardness, it serves as a critical component in a comprehensive water treatment approach for Evergreen residents, ensuring microbiologically safe water. It works well in combination with other treatment methods that target iron, sulfur, and hardness.
